RESTRICTED: Managers Only — Quillbrook Retail Pilot

Finance folks, heads up: we've agreed a 12-store pilot with the Quillbrook chain, running the Mosshart shelf units through one full season. They cover fit-out; we carry inventory risk, which is the bit to watch. Expect invoicing to run through a consignment model — unusual for us, so flag any booking questions early. Pilot economics look thin on purpose. Why we're doing it anyway is explained in the confidential note below.

board note of kageg-bahof: The renewal with Holwynax Holdings closes at $2 million a year, 5 percent below the last contract. Project Ulaath slips by two quarters because of the supplier delay.

# Break-Glass: Catalog Cache Invalidation

Scope: the Pinrow product catalog at Veldstone Retail. If stale prices persist after a purge and the Hollowmere invalidation queue is wedged, use break-glass to flush the edge tier directly. Contractors: get verbal sign-off from the catalog lead first. Steps: open the Hollowmere admin shell, select emergency-flush, confirm the tenant, and run it once — repeated flushes thrash the origin. Access is logged and expires after 20 minutes. Unseal the admin shell with the passphrase below.

recovery phrase for kahop-tajog: istix-casvan

# Environments: PinPoint Autocomplete

Three environments: dev, staging, prod. Dev resets nightly. Staging mirrors prod data minus the Harwick dataset. Promotions go dev → staging → prod; no direct prod pushes. Staging smoke tests must pass before release sign-off. Prod config is locked behind change review. Current staging values are as follows.

settings of kafop-fahog:
PRAWYN_PIN=8793
PRAWYN_METRICS_HOST=metrics.prawyn.lumiccorp.corp
PRAWYN_LOG_LEVEL=warn
PRAWYN_TENANT=kasox

Handover note for reception cover: the basement archive room at Copperfield House holds the signed visitor logs and old lease files. It's the grey door past the boiler room, left at the bottom of the stairs. The light switch is outside the door. Keep the door shut after each visit. To unlock it, enter the code below.

staff pass of kawip-hawef = bdg-QLP-2